Transaction 791787f686bccf28e07f69a291762f2f65a29b6fc1eb3a1754bd1c94b2a2eb41

1 Input
2 Outputs
  • 791787f686bccf28e07f69a291762f2f65a29b6fc1eb3a1754bd1c94b2a2eb41:0
  • value  92160457
    address  17vRrkDvXjMub32TQGEWmKFAe3ELmwXFWA
  • 791787f686bccf28e07f69a291762f2f65a29b6fc1eb3a1754bd1c94b2a2eb41:1
  • value  407775907
    address  1NHWseurKeBZnX9M9Ue578rmT6FMtiEZqr